In 2022, the sanctuary was deemed structurally unsound. The organ was removed by Berghaus as the sanctuary is rebuilt and repaired. Once repaired, the organ will be reinstalled.
Identified through online information from Richard C Greene. -- Rebuild of existing organ. The 1869 Wm. Johnson organ was electrified by Reuter in 1952. It was enlarged from 2 manuals, 22 ranks to 3 manuals, 33 ranks.
